RED LION -Paul C. Valet, 84, passed away Wednesday, December 16, 2009 at his residence with his loving family by his side. He was the husband of Loretta E. (Shirey) Valet to whom he was married 51 years on October 25th. A funeral service will be 2:00 p.m. Monday, December 21, 2009 at Heffner Funeral Chapel & Crematory, Inc., 1551 Kenneth Road, York, with his pastor, the Rev. Jonathan L. Bausman officiating. A viewing will be held 1-2:00 p.m. Monday at the funeral home. Burial will follow in Greenmount Cemetery with a flag folding provided for by the York County Veterans Honor Guard. Mr. Valet was born October 25, 1925 in Philadelphia, PA, the son of the late Paul C. and Amelia (Stuz) Valet. He was a former employee of General Electric, Philadelphia for 19 years until his retirement. He was a member of Aldersgate United Methodist Church, York. Mr. Valet was a U.S. Navy Veteran serving his country during WWII. He was an avid Philadelphia Eagles, Phillies, Penn State and Navy Football fan. He enjoyed taking trips with his wife, her sister and brother-in-law, as well as going bowling and to the movies. He will be remembered by those who knew him as a very personable man who always said hello. In addition to his wife, Mr. Valet is survived by a brother-in-law, Leonard Y. Tarman; and several cousins in NJ, FL, and Germany. In lieu of flowers, memorial contributions may be made to Aldersgate United Methodist Church, 397 Tyler Run Road, York, PA 17403.
